New Data Shows Martha's Rule Saving Hundreds of Lives

A scheme giving NHS patients and families independent access to urgent clinical help has shown strong early results. In its first 18 months, nearly 1,800 NHS staff made calls under Martha's Rule, with new figures suggesting around 534 life-saving interventions were triggered. The scheme was named after Martha Mills, a 13-year-old who died from sepsis in 2021 after her family's concerns were not escalated.
